Beauty on the Streets: DJ J.Phlip

DJ J.Phlip

Name: Jessica Rose Phillippe aka J.Phlip

Age: 27

Occupation: DJ/Producer (tech.funk.booty.bass.house.music)

Location: Berlin/San Francisco

Website: http://listn.to/jphlipsgroupiepage, facebook.com/jphlip, myspace.com/jphlipsmusics, dirtybirdrecords.com

“My dad once told me to figure out what i really love doing – and then figure out how to get paid for it. This has led me to a life 100% consumed by music, despite graduating with this crazy engineering degree. I have always been scared to death of being in front of a crowd – large or small – until one day i tried it out behind two turntables and a mixer and felt completely comfortable – and i knew that was where i was meant to be. “

My style is: contrasting – ghetto meets sexy, leather/studs meets girlie, basic meets bling, new meets vintage, cheap meets designer, goth meets fairy.

The best part about being a DJ is: All the hot groupies at the club!!! hehehe just kidding…of course…making people lose themselves dancing, screaming, sweating, throwing their hands in the air! And feeling the energy in the room that is created between you, the music, the sound, and the dance floor all interacting. Seeing everyone go nuts to a track you produced is really freaking cool too!
